Lemon business hits the tracks to sweet success

By Chen Yingqun | China Daily | Updated: 2018-11-27 07:25

Businessman Dai Xiaoping never expected that the lemons handled by his company would one day reach overseas dining tables, but the Belt and Road Initiative proved to be a turning point.

Dai, the founder of lemon processing company the Huida Group, which was established in 2012 and is based in Chongqing's Tongnan district, said his lemons had not been exported before the BRI was proposed in 2013.

"The BRI brought overseas buyers to Tongnan and helped them get to know about our business," he said.
